No, Diluted EPS is not required to be disclosed by the SMC's & SME's, otherwise known as Level II & Level III Entities, respectively.
As per Accounting Standard 20, 'Earning Per Share', All Entities are required to shown on the face of P&L A/c :-
1. BEPS
2. DEPS
3. Reconciliation Statement, reconciling the two Ratios - BEPS & DEPS
But, Partial Exemption is available to SMC's & SME's in that they do not need to disclose the DEPS, and therefore the Reconciliation Statement is also not needed. They only need to disclose the BEPS.
Note :- Remember, any of the Partial Exemptions, given in AS - 15/19/20/28/29 is not mandatory to avail. It is up to the Entities to decide whether they want to avail the Exemption or not.
